The Grand Luang Prabang, Affiliated by Meliá
This picturesque resort, once owned by nationalist hero Prince Phetsarath, stands immersed in an estate of almost six hectares. Consisting of eight buildings, including a palace built in 1920, this idyllic hotel is perched on a cliff that offers one of the most spectacular panoramic views in the Luang Prabang area. Sleep surrounded by beautiful mountains and wild nature in an exceptional travel experience.
Known as the Xiengkeo Palace, The Grand Luang Prabang Affiliated by Meliá is an architectural gem that offers a peaceful retreat in a tranquil atmosphere by the Mekong River. The hotel features rooms with French colonial design and Laotian touches, as well as balconies overlooking our manicured gardens, lotus ponds and the surrounding area.
